Chapter 7 - VoIP Settings<br />
SIP Setting<br />
• DTMF – Enables the sending of dual-tone multi-frequency (touch tone) phone<br />
signals over the VoIP connection. There are several methods to choose from:<br />
» No DTMF: The DTMF signals are not sent over the VoIP connection.<br />
» In-band Mode: The DTMF signals are sent over the RTP voice stream. In<br />
the case when low-bandwidth codecs are used, the DTMF signals may be<br />
distorted.<br />
» 2833 Relay: Uses the RFC 2833 method to relay the DTMF signals over<br />
the RTP voice stream without any distortion. (This is the default.)<br />
» Both In-band and 2833: Uses the best method depending on the called<br />
party.<br />
• Invite Timeout – The time that the unit waits for a response to a SIP Invite<br />
message before a call fails. If network connections are slow and many SIP calls<br />
fail, you may need to increase this timeout value. (Range: 1-32 seconds;<br />
Default: 12 seconds)<br />
• T.38 Option – Selects the method to use when sending fax messages over the<br />
VoIP network from a fax machine connected to one of the RJ-11 Phone ports<br />
on the <strong>BreezeMAX</strong> <strong>Si</strong> <strong>2000</strong>. (Default: Voice and T.38 Fax Relay)<br />
» T.38 Fax Relay: The SIP protocol sets up the VoIP call, then the T.38 Fax<br />
Relay protocol sends the fax data over the network.<br />
» Voice and T.38 Fax Relay: Enables voice calls and faxes to be sent from<br />
the Phone port connection. When a fax tone signal is detected on the port,<br />
the T.38 Fax Relay standard is used instead of the voice codec.<br />
» Voice and Fax Pass Through: Enables voice calls and faxes to be sent<br />
from the Phone port connection. For this option, fax signals are sent over<br />
the VoIP network using the voice codec, just as if it were a voice call.<br />
